What Are Diet Medications?
Diet medications, likewise called anti-obesity medications, are prescription drugs focused on assisting people in reducing weight by suppressing appetite, increasing sensations of fullness, or obstructing fat absorption. They are normally advised for individuals with a body mass index (BMI) higher than 30 or those with a BMI over 27 who likewise have weight-related health conditions.

Appetite suppressants work by influencing neurotransmitters in the brain, especially those that control appetite. They can be efficient in the brief term and may cause considerable weight reduction when combined with way of life changes.

Absorption inhibitors avoid the body from absorbing a portion of the fat from the food consumed, efficiently lowering calorie intake. They may be useful for people who have a hard time to handle their fat usage through dietary modifications alone.

Hormonal modulators mimic the impacts of naturally happening hormones that manage appetite and glucose metabolism. This class of medications can also improve metabolic health, making them reliable for [appetitzüGler](http://39.96.211.118:3000/schmerzmittelpillen5536) weight management.
